============= Multi-Tenancy ============= Multi-tenancy architectures allow a single application to serve multiple distinct clients (tenants) while guaranteeing data isolation. SQLSpec supports three common multi-tenancy patterns: 1. **Discriminator Column (Shared Schema)**: All tenants share the same tables, isolated by a tenant ID column. 2. **Schema-Per-Tenant**: Each tenant has their own schema inside a shared database instance. 3. **Database-Per-Tenant**: Each tenant has a completely separate database connection or configuration. .. contents:: On this page :local: :depth: 2 Pattern 1: Discriminator Column (Shared Schema) ============================================== In this pattern, every tenant row includes a ``tenant_id`` column. SQLSpec allows you to enforce tenant isolation consistently using query builder helpers, named SQL parameter binding, or custom filters. Using the Query Builder ----------------------- .. code-block:: python from sqlspec.adapters.asyncpg import AsyncpgDriver from sqlspec.builder import sql async def get_tenant_orders(driver: AsyncpgDriver, tenant_id: str, status: str) -> list[dict]: query = ( sql.select("id", "total", "status") .from_("orders") .where(tenant_id=tenant_id, status=status) ) return (await driver.select(query)).as_dicts() Using Tenant Statement Filters ------------------------------ For dynamic query filtering, you can write a tenant filter or combine standard filters: .. code-block:: python from dataclasses import dataclass from sqlspec.adapters.asyncpg import AsyncpgDriver from sqlspec.core import StatementFilter @dataclass(frozen=True) class TenantFilter(StatementFilter): tenant_id: str def apply(self, statement: str) -> tuple[str, dict[str, str]]: # Appends tenant isolation predicate to outgoing SQL return f"SELECT * FROM ({statement}) AS _tenant_subq WHERE tenant_id = :tenant_id", { "tenant_id": self.tenant_id } Pattern 2: Schema-Per-Tenant ============================ In PostgreSQL, each tenant can have an isolated schema (e.g. ``tenant_123``). You can dynamically set the schema when acquiring a session or setting the PostgreSQL ``search_path``: .. code-block:: python from sqlspec.adapters.asyncpg import AsyncpgConfig, AsyncpgDriver async def get_tenant_session( config: AsyncpgConfig, tenant_slug: str ) -> AsyncpgDriver: session = config.create_driver() # Set search_path to tenant schema with public fallback await session.execute(f"SET search_path TO {tenant_slug}, public") return session When using transaction blocks: .. code-block:: python async with session.transaction(): await session.execute("SET LOCAL search_path TO tenant_a") results = await session.select("SELECT * FROM users") Pattern 3: Database-Per-Tenant (Dynamic Routing) ================================================ In high-compliance or isolated deployments, each tenant has a distinct database instance or DSN. You can register multiple database configs with SQLSpec or register them dynamically at runtime: .. code-block:: python from sqlspec import SQLSpec from sqlspec.adapters.asyncpg import AsyncpgConfig sqlspec = SQLSpec() # Register known tenants at startup sqlspec.add_config( AsyncpgConfig( connection_config={"dsn": "postgresql://localhost/tenant_alpha"}, extension_config={"fastapi": {"session_key": "tenant_alpha"}}, ) ) sqlspec.add_config( AsyncpgConfig( connection_config={"dsn": "postgresql://localhost/tenant_beta"}, extension_config={"fastapi": {"session_key": "tenant_beta"}}, ) ) # Acquire session by tenant key async def fetch_tenant_data(tenant_key: str): config = sqlspec.get_config(tenant_key) async with sqlspec.provide_session(config) as session: return await session.select("SELECT * FROM settings") Dynamically Registering Configurations -------------------------------------- If tenant databases are provisioned at runtime, dynamically add configs to the shared ``SQLSpec`` registry: .. code-block:: python def ensure_tenant_config(sqlspec: SQLSpec, tenant_id: str, dsn: str) -> AsyncpgConfig: key = f"tenant_{tenant_id}" try: return sqlspec.get_config(key) # type: ignore[return-value] except KeyError: new_config = AsyncpgConfig( connection_config={"dsn": dsn}, ) sqlspec.add_config(new_config) return new_config .. seealso:: - :doc:`/usage/configuration` for multi-database configuration options. - :doc:`/usage/filtering` for statement filter composition. - :doc:`/usage/framework_integrations` for wiring tenant sessions into web frameworks.
